Description

Hornbeck Offshore Services, Inc., is a provider of marine transportation services to exploration and production, oilfield service, offshore construction and United States military customers. The Company focuses on providing advanced marine solutions to meet the evolving needs of the deepwater and ultra-deepwater energy industry in domestic and foreign locations. The Company provides marine transportation through two business segments: Upstream segment and Downstream segment. Its Upstream segment owns and operates one of the youngest and largest fleets of United States flagged, new generation offshore supply vessel (OSVs) and Multi Purpose Supply Vessel (MPSVs). Its Downstream segment owns and operates a fleet of ocean-going tugs and double-hulled tank barges that transport petroleum products, primarily in the northeastern United States and the Gulf of Mexico.
